Classic Cookies

When you think of cookies, the mind often wanders to the classics. Let’s explore some staples that every cookie lover should know!

Chocolate Chip Cookies

That warm, gooey bite of a chocolate chip cookie is an iconic experience. The balance of sweet, melty chocolate with a slightly crisp edge and a soft center is enough to send anyone into a blissful state. Did you know that chocolate chip cookies were invented by Ruth Wakefield in the 1930s? Now, they are a household favorite worldwide.

Oatmeal Raisin Cookies

For those who love a chewy texture combined with the natural sweetness of raisins, oatmeal raisin cookies are a must-try. Oats provide a unique heartiness and health benefits, making these cookies a popular choice among those seeking a nutritious indulgence.

Peanut Butter Cookies

The nutty, rich flavor of peanut butter cookies is irresistible. Their crumbly texture combined with a fork’s signature crisscross pattern not only makes them delicious but also eye-catching.

International Cookies

Cookies don’t just belong to one cuisine; they span the globe with unique flavors and ingredients. Let’s take a wander through some delightful international varieties.

Italian Biscotti

If you enjoy dipping your cookie in coffee, then biscotti is a traditional Italian favorite. Known for their crunchy texture, these twice-baked cookies come in various flavors such as almond, pistachio, and even chocolate.

Mexican Wedding Cookies

These buttery treats, also known as polvorones, are rolled in powdered sugar and often contain nuts. The light, crumbly texture invites compliments at every gathering.

French Madeleines

Not exactly a cookie, but worth mentioning, French madeleines are small sponge cakes that resemble a shell shape. They are perfect paired with tea or coffee and offer a delightful balance of sweetness with a hint of lemon.

Gluten-Free Cookies

More people are looking to enjoy cookies without gluten, and the variety of gluten-free options is expanding rapidly.

Almond Flour Cookies

Using almond flour instead of wheat flour creates a gluten-free cookie that is both delicious and nutritious. These cookies are typically lighter and can be flavored with a variety of ingredients, such as dark chocolate or vanilla.

Coconut Macaroons

Coconut macaroons are naturally gluten-free and combine shredded coconut with egg whites and sugar. These are chewy, sweet, and perfect for celebrating any occasion.

Baking Tips for Success

Creating the perfect cookie goes beyond just having the right ingredients. Here are some essential tips to ensure your baking is a success.

Measure Ingredients Accurately

Precision is crucial in baking. Use a kitchen scale or measuring cups to ensure you’re using the correct amounts. It makes a huge difference in the final product!

Use Quality Ingredients

Select fresh, high-quality ingredients for the best flavor. For example, use pure vanilla extract instead of imitation, and opt for high-quality chocolate.

Don’t Overmix the Dough

Overmixing can lead to tough cookies. Once the components are combined, mix just until everything is incorporated to avoid activating the gluten too much.

FAQs

1. What is the best way to store homemade cookies?

Homemade cookies should be stored in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week. For longer storage, consider freezing them.

2. Can I substitute ingredients in cookie recipes?

Yes! Many ingredients can be substituted, such as using applesauce instead of butter or mashed bananas instead of eggs, depending on the recipe.

3. How can I make my cookies chewier?

For chewier cookies, try adding more brown sugar than white sugar, underbaking them slightly, or incorporating ingredients like oats or coconut.
